Anell Alexis gets MVP of the Week award for Panamanian LPB (by Hoops Agents)- October 14, 2021
The 31-year old power forward had the game-high 36 points adding five rebounds and three assists for Universitarios in his team's victory, helping them to beat Dragones (#4, 7-5) 92-84. The game was between two of the league's top four teams. It allowed Universitarios to consolidate first place in the Panamanian LPB. Universitarios have a solid 9-2 record. In the team's last game Alexis had a remarkable 54.5% from 2-point range and got five three-pointers out of 6 attempts. He turned to be Universitarios' top player in his first season with the team. Anell Alexis averages this season 22.4ppg. The second most remarkable performance in last round's games was 26-year old American forward Zacarry Douglas (203-F-95) of Dragones. Douglas impressed basketball fans with a double-double of 21 points and 10 rebounds. Bad luck as Dragones lost that game 84-92 to the higher-ranked Universitarios (#1, 9-2). It was definitely game of the week between two contenders to the title. Dragones still maintains its place in the top 4 of the standings, even despite this loss. His team's 7-5 record is not bad at all. Douglas is a newcomer at Dragones and it seems he did not have too much trouble to become one of team's leaders. The third best performed player last round was another Dragones' star - Gil Atencio (202-PF-96). Atencio scored 18 points and grabbed nine rebounds. He was another key player of Dragones, helping his team with a 95-67 easy win against slightly lower-ranked Caballos (#6, 2-10). Atencio has a very solid season. In 12 games in Panama he scored 10.9ppg. He also has 6.1rpg and FGP: 60.0%. Other top performing players last week: 4. Luis Dinolis (185-SG-93) of Panteras - 18 points, 2 rebounds and 2 assists The Player of the week is selected based on efficiency calculation, but also including game result, importance of the game, if played recorded double-double/triple-double, etc. The efficiency formula is a combination of various formulas used by different basketball organizations/leagues. We got involved many basketball scouts and journalists to assure it's accuracy. The formula: 1.5*PTS + 3* (REB+AST+ST+BL-TO) - 2*BSAG - 4*PF + 3*PFRV + 4* (2FGPM+3FGPM) + 1.5*FTM - 3* (2FGPA-2FGPM) - 3* (3FGPA-3FGPM) - (FTA-FTM)
